What are CSGO Skins and How Do They Fuel Gambling?
To understand CSGO https://cs-gambling-sitesojcv287.theburnward.com/7-things-about-csgo-gambling-you-ll-kick-yourself-for-not-knowing gambling sites, one need to first understand the idea of "skins." In CSGO, gamers earn or purchase randomized weapon surfaces through in-game drops or containers called cases. While these skins do not offer any competitive benefit, they possess real-world financial value.
Due To The Fact That Valve (the game's developer) permitted gamers to trade these items freely through the Steam Community Market and peer-to-peer platforms, third-party entrepreneurs realized these digital products could operate as a digital currency. Users might transfer their virtual skins onto external websites, transform them into website credits, and wager them on video games of opportunity or skill.

Utilizing a CSGO gambling site generally requires a standardized process. While methods have progressed due to crackdowns by Valve, the general workflow stays similar across a lot of platforms:
- Account Association: The user logs into the gambling site using their Steam qualifications via OpenID authentication.
- Inventory Sync: The platform accesses the user's Steam stock to display readily available skins.
- Deposit: The user chooses skins to bet. This is done either through automated bot trades (where the user sends out skins to a bot) or through peer-to-peer (P2P) systems where the user trades directly with another gamer.
- Betting: Skins are transformed into platform credits, cryptocurrency, or kept as a balance to play video games.
- Withdrawal: If a user wins, they pick brand-new skins from the website's inventory to withdraw back to their personal Steam account through a trade offer.
Risks Associated with CSGO Gambling
While the excitement of winning rare, expensive knives or gloves draws in countless gamers, CSGO gambling carries substantial dangers that participants should browse.
- Lack of Regulation: Many CSGO gambling sites run offshore in jurisdictions with loose regulative oversight, implying users have little option if a website declines to pay payouts.
- Provably Fair Algorithms vs. Manipulation: While numerous respectable sites use cryptographic "provably fair" systems to prove game results are random, uncontrolled sites can easily rig video games against the player.
- Minor Gambling: Because the entry barrier is tied to a video game played greatly by minors, countless underage users have actually historically gotten to these platforms.
- Financial Loss: Much like traditional gambling, the house always has an edge. Many users experience extreme financial losses chasing unusual virtual products.
- Account Bans: Valve actively fights third-party gambling by banning Trade URLs, API keys, and accounts related to known commercial gambling bots, which can result in a user losing access to their whole Steam stock.
Valve's Crackdown and Industry Evolution
The relationship in between Valve and third-party gambling sites has been adversarial for years. In 2016, Valve issued cease-and-desist letters to lots of significant skin gambling websites, arguing that they breached the Steam Subscriber Agreement and facilitated minor gambling.
In reaction, the market adapted. Sites moved from utilizing Steam accounts straight for automatic trading to utilizing cryptocurrencies (Bitcoin, Ethereum, GBPT) or peer-to-peer trading systems. More just recently, Valve implemented a 7-day trade hang on recently traded products, seriously interrupting the instant liquidity that made skin gambling so popular. In spite of these difficulties, the marketplace continues to adapt, discovering new loopholes and technological workarounds to remain functional.
